鋼粒鑽进目前对我們仍然是一項新的技术,对它的操作方法和鑽进规律还沒有摸索出一套比較完整的經驗。为了进一步研究这一方面的实际經驗,願將我們实际工作中的体会写出与大家商榷。一、有关鋼粒鑽进的技術規範問題 1.投砂方法:鋼粒鑽进的投砂方法和数量的多少取决于所鑽岩石硬度、可鑽性和鋼粒質量。岩石愈硬鋼粒質量愈善,消耗量則愈多。但是如投入的鋼粒过多,则其比鑽粒更易于磨耗岩心管和岩心,同时有碍效率的提高。因此在硬岩层鑽进中适于采用多次投砂法,而在較软岩层中,可采用一次投砂法,其数量以能滿足囘次提鑽長度需要为原則。
Steel pellet drilling is still a new technology for us at present, and it has not worked out a complete set of experiences on its operating methods and drilling rules. In order to further study the practical experience in this field, we would like to write down our experience in actual work to discuss with you. First, the technical specifications of the drilling of steel 1. Casting method: shot blasting sand method and the amount of how much depends on the rock hardness, drillability and the quality of steel. The harder the rock, the better the quality of the grains and the more consumption. However, if too much steel is thrown in, it is more susceptible to abrasion of the core tube and core than the drill bit while hindering an increase in efficiency. Therefore, it is appropriate to adopt multiple sand casting methods when drilling in hard rock formations. In relatively soft rock formations, a sand casting method may be adopted, and the number can meet the principle of requiring the length of backhoe drillings.
